Firmware Update
Presentation
Update the EcoStruxure Panel Server to the latest version to obtain the latest features and keep up-to-date with security patches.
Use the latest version of EcoStruxure Power Commission to update your product to the latest available version. It is also possible to perform a firmware update using the embedded webpages.
All firmware designed for the EcoStruxure Panel Server is signed using the Schneider Electric public key infrastructure to provide integrity and authenticity of the firmware running on the EcoStruxure Panel Server.

Updating Firmware With EcoStruxure Power Commission Software
The prerequisites for updating the firmware with EcoStruxure Power Commission software are the following:
-
The latest version of EcoStruxure Power Commission software must be downloaded and installed on the PC.
-
The PC must be connected to a power supply. Standby mode must be deactivated to avoid the possibility of interruption during the update.
-
The PC must be connected to the EcoStruxure Panel Server.

At the end of the firmware update process, the EcoStruxure Panel Server needs to be rebooted. After the reboot, check that the firmware version is the latest to make sure that the update is effective. If the firmware version is still the old one, perform the firmware update again. If the problem persists, contact your Schneider Electric Customer Care Center.

Updating Firmware With the EcoStruxure Panel Server Webpages
To update the firmware with the EcoStruxure Panel Server webpages, proceed as follows:
-
Make sure that the EcoStruxure Panel Server is continuously powered during the firmware update.
-
From your Schneider Electric country website, download the latest version of EcoStruxure Panel Server firmware to your PC.

-
Import the firmware file and follow the instructions.
-
Reboot the EcoStruxure Panel Server to update the firmware.
NOTE: The EcoStruxure Panel Server webpages cannot be accessed while the EcoStruxure Panel Server is rebooting. -
After the reboot, check that the firmware version is the latest to make sure that the update is effective.
If the firmware version is still the old one, perform the firmware update again. If the problem persists, contact your Schneider Electric Customer Care Center.
